NIGERIA: Security agencies tasked on demolition of Ojukwu library

Dim Chukwuemeka Odumegwu-OjukwuTHE interim National Working committee, NWC, of All Progressives Grand Alliance, APGA, has called on security agents to fish out those behind the demolition of Ojukwu Memorial Library project in Owerri, Imo State, with a view to bringing them to book.

The library erected by the leader of the Movement for the Actualisation of the Sovereign State of Biafra, MASSOB, Chief Ralph Uwazurike, to immortalise the Ikemba Nnewi and Eze Igbo Gburugburu, Dim Chukwuemeka Odumegwu-Ojukwu, was to be commissioned next month.

Interim National Chairman of APGA, Maxi Okwu in a statement, yesterday, described the act as outrageous, unjust and detestable.

According to him, “It is a sacrilege in Igboland for any person or group to conspire and destroy a befitting monument in honour of the People’s General.”
